### Action Item: Spoolhaven Retry Storm

From last Tuesday's outage: the Spoolhaven print service retried failed jobs without backoff, saturating the render pool. Fix merged; retries now use capped exponential backoff with jitter. Owner will monitor for a week before closing. The agreed retry constants are recorded below.

constants for yadup-kajof:
RATE_LIMITS = {
    "zorwyn": 1,
    "druwyn": 1,
}

Welcome to the Ferrowick plugin platform. All calls to the upstream Catalog API pass through our circuit breaker; after five consecutive failures it opens for 30 seconds and your plugin receives a cached response flagged as stale. Handle that flag gracefully. If the breaker sticks open, request a manual reset and supply the recovery passphrase shown below.

vault phrase of yagag-kadup = belael-druius-rusax-kelox

**Ticket TTS-1182: Solver deadlock with plugin constraints**

External constraint plugins for the Schoolforge timetable solver can trigger a deadlock when two plugins register conflicting room-capacity rules on the same period. The solver loops on backtracking instead of reporting infeasibility. Workaround: declare rule priorities explicitly in the plugin manifest. A proper conflict detector ships next release; the affected solver build is identified by the token below.

pipeline stamp: htk9_ce63042d9

MINUTES — Management Meeting, Hollowbrook Office

Present: Garth, Lenna, Osric. Apologies: Mireille.

Agenda: Budget request for the Tindercrest tooling upgrade. Lenna presented costings; Osric queried depreciation schedule. Request approved in principle, pending finance sign-off. Garth to submit revised figures Friday. Next review in four weeks. The confidential note on plans is recorded below.

internal memo for hafog-hadug: The pricing group signed off on a budget of $16.1 million for Project Gorir. The renewal with Oliionax Systems closes at $14.1 million a year, 46 percent above the last contract.